- واژهنامه · Merriam-Webster Collegiate Dictionary ker·nel n. Pronunciation: ' kər-n ə l Function: noun Etymology: Middle English, from Old English cyrnel, diminutive of corn Date: before 12th century 1 chiefly dialect : a fruit seed 2 : the inner softer part of a seed, fruit stone, or nut 3 : a whole seed of a cereal 4 : a central or essential part : GERM 5 : a subset of the elements of one set (as a group) that a function (as a homomorphism) maps onto an identity element of another set
